The Japanese Student Association (JSA) at Pennsylvania State University will host its annual Matsuri festival on Sunday, April 6, 2025, from 12:00 PM to 4:00 PM. The event will take place in Alumni Hall at the HUB-Robeson Center, located at 288 Pollock Road, University Park, PA 16802. This cultural celebration is free and open to all Penn State students, faculty, and members of the State College community.
Matsuri, meaning "festival" in Japanese, is a lively celebration of Japanese culture. The event features arcade-style games, hands-on crafts, delicious festival food, and exciting cultural performances. The 2025 theme, “Strolling Through the Streets of Japan,” brings the spirit of Japanese street life to campus, with displays inspired by conbini (Japanese convenience stores) and yatai (traditional food stalls).
Attendees can enjoy a variety of immersive activities and performances that offer a taste of Japan right in the heart of Penn State.
